Transaction 96e40300c1ef4aef86d8cfe469a5661cdfd280202428f9652a5659a9ebb824da
1 Input
1 Output
-
96e40300c1ef4aef86d8cfe469a5661cdfd280202428f9652a5659a9ebb824da:0
- value
- 14805126
- script pubkey
- OP_0 OP_PUSHBYTES_20 5563a540ac43817234081a5e58bc906666ad471b
- address
- bc1q24362s9vgwqhydqgrf0930ysven263cmfygm74